Real-World Performance Testing

When tested under demanding livestock conditions, permethrin insecticide performed as expected: fly populations dropped by 80% within the first 48 hours following application. Many users reported seeing noticeable relief from biting insects on dairy and beef cattle, improving overall livestock health.

As a stable insect spray, this product’s 10% emulsifiable concentrate formula offers measurable results. When applied at the 1-ounce-per-100-pound dosage, animals saw residual protection for up to 3-4 weeks—even during wet weather. For a breakdown of active ingredient performance and application safety, view the FBN official tech sheet.

This tool can be diluted for use with mist blowers, foggers, and back-rubber devices, fitting a variety of farm management routines. However, limitations include a strong chemical odor and the need for protective gear during application to avoid irritation. The solution cannot be sprayed on feed, food, or water sources. Always allow sufficient drying time and follow label guidance to protect sensitive breeds.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Can this be used for both indoor and outdoor farm pest control?
    Yes, this product is labeled for use both directly on livestock and in their resting areas, making it versatile for multiple environments.
  • How often should I reapply for tick and mite spray effectiveness?
    Generally, reapplication every 3-4 weeks is sufficient, but refer to the label and adjust based on pest pressure.
  • Is permethrin insecticide safe for lactating dairy cattle?
    Yes, the label allows its use on dairy cattle including those in lactation, but udders must be washed thoroughly before milking each time.
  • Will this animal insecticide irritate the skin of sensitive animals?
    Some animals may have mild skin irritation after application. It’s best to test a small area first and monitor for reactions—consult a vet if unsure.
